Frequently Asked Questions about Detroit

How much are Studio apartments in Detroit?

There are currently 342 Studio Apartments in Detroit with rent ranges from $456 to $3,175 with an average price of $1,205.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Detroit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Detroit ranges from $410 to $5,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,412.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Detroit c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Detroit range from $457 to $7,750.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,785.

How expensive are Detroit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 301 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Detroit on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$525 to $8,589 - averaging $2,035 for the location.
